Why is My Shein Order Taking So Long to Process?

When shopping online, it’s common to experience delays in order processing. This is especially true for retailers like Shein, which deals with a high volume of orders daily. Here are some reasons why your Shein order may be taking longer than expected to process:

Order Size and Complexity

Larger orders or orders with multiple items generally take more time to process. This is because Shein needs to ensure that all items are available and in stock, and that they are properly packaged and shipped to prevent damage.

Payment Verification

Shein needs to verify your payment details before processing your order. This process can take some time, especially if there are any issues with your payment method or if you’re making a large purchase.

Item Availability

If an item in your order is out of stock, Shein may need to wait for a restock before they can process your order. This can significantly delay the processing time.

Peak Shopping Seasons

During peak shopping seasons like holidays or sale events, Shein experiences a surge in orders. This can lead to longer processing times as the company tries to keep up with demand.

Shipping Delays

Once your order is processed, it still needs to be shipped. Shipping delays can occur due to weather conditions, carrier delays, or customs clearance issues.

How to Check the Status of Your Order

You can track the status of your Shein order at any time by following these steps:

  • Go to the Shein website or use the Shein app.
  • Log in to your account.
  • Click on “My Orders.”
  • Locate the order you’re interested in and click on “View Details.”
  • The order status will be displayed, along with an estimated delivery date.

What to Do if Your Order is Delayed

If your Shein order is taking longer than expected to process, here are some steps you can take:

  • Contact Shein customer support: Reach out to Shein’s customer support team through live chat, email, or phone. They can provide you with updates on your order status and assist with any issues.
  • Be patient: Order processing delays are common, especially during peak seasons. Allow a few extra days for your order to be processed and shipped.
  • Check the estimated delivery date: Keep in mind the estimated delivery date provided by Shein when placing your order. This date gives you an idea of when to expect your order.
